HUNTINGTON, W.Va. (AP) Ryan Taylor scored a layup with 6.9 seconds left to give Marshall the lead, then added a free throw to cement a 106-104 victory over North Texas in an epic Conference USA regular season finale Saturday.

North Texas had the ball and the lead with 24.7 seconds left, but turned the ball over on the in-bounds pass, allowing Taylor the chance to score and take the lead. The Mean Green then stepped out of bounds with 5.6 seconds left and was forced to foul Taylor.

Lawson's layup at the buzzer to tie the game did not fall.

Marshall (17-14, 10-8) entered the game tied with Alabama-Birmingham for sixth place in Conference USA. The teams split their regular season series.

Taylor finished with 29 points and grabbed 10 rebounds to lead the Thundering Herd. Jon Elmore added 19 points.

A.J. Lawson scored 26 points to lead North Texas (8-22, 2-16). J-Mychal Reese had 25 points.
